1.6. Problemas, errores, problemas
Cómo vaciar y actualizar el firmware μFR y probar el lector
Last Updated: marzo 30, 2023Cómo enjuagar-actualizar el firmware μFR – Actualización y degradación del firmware del lector/escritor μFR Si su dispositivo es un lector/escritor μFR no inalámbrico (Nano, Classic CS, Classic, Advance, XL), todos pueden actualizar su firmware utilizando la herramienta de software de flasheo disponible en https://code.d-logic.com/nfc-rfid-reader-sdk/ufr_plus-flasher-oneclick. Cuando ejecuta inicialmente el software de parpadeo en una máquina con Windows, puede recibir una advertencia emergente como se muestra a continuación. Asegúrese de hacer clic en el botón Ejecutar de todos modos y habilite esta aplicación. Si no ha completado el paso anterior y tiene problemas para iniciar la herramienta de software, aún puede habilitarla en Seguridad de Windows / Firewall y protección de red, como se ve a continuación. Además, utilice el uFR Plus Flasher y seleccione la versión de firmware más reciente: Ahora, encuentre la versión de firmware deseada. Escriba el número ordinal del firmware (el último recomendado) y pulse Intro. Espere a que el software complete el proceso. Después de escuchar el sonido del pitido del lector, se completa el parpadeo del firmware. Asegúrese de no interrumpir este proceso hasta que esté completamente hecho. Si se interrumpió por alguna razón (el cable del lector se desenchufó, se cortó la alimentación,...
¿Cuándo se recomienda una actualización de RF Booster?
Last Updated: marzo 30, 2023La actualización de RF Booster es opcional para la mayoría del hardware de la línea de productos Digital Logic.Su propósito es potenciar el campo de RF del lector ...
uFR Reader Writer en macOS – Controladores FTDI y consejos de permisos de comunicación
Last Updated: marzo 30, 2023uFR Reader Writer en macOS Sugerencias para controladores FTDI y permisos de comunicación macOS tiene una estructura un poco diferente a Linux, por lo que la comunicación con el lector no se puede habilitar con un script simple disponible para usuarios de Linux. La habilitación de la comunicación entre el software y el lector conectado por USB varía según la versión de macOS. Las versiones del sistema operativo de Mavericks (versión 10.9) y superiores ya tienen el controlador AppleUSBFTDI. La interfaz se adapta al kext FTDI, que a su vez crea un puerto serie BSD para su uso en la capa de aplicación. La aplicación abre el puerto serie para comunicarse con el hardware. Por otro lado, los dispositivos μFR conectados por USB implementan controladores de cliente de usuario para comunicarse directamente con el dispositivo desde el espacio de usuario (controlador FTDI D2XX). Por lo tanto, la comunicación con el software puede verse afectada por la presencia del kext AppleUSBFTDI. Es posible que las aplicaciones de software no puedan abrir una conexión con el hardware porque IOKit ya ha hecho coincidir el controlador AppleUSBFTDI con el dispositivo. La solución en este caso es descargar los controladores AppleUSBFTDI antes de instalar...
Escritor de lector RFID μFR Nano Online NFC conectado por USB en la Raspberry Pi
Last Updated: marzo 30, 2023Escritor de lector RFID μFR Nano Online NFC conectado por USB en la Raspberry Pi Para conectar y ejecutar el lector μFR Nano Online conectado al puerto USB de Raspberry Pi, siga las instrucciones a continuación: 1) INSTALACIÓN DEL LECTOR NFC μFR NANO ONLINE CONECTADO POR USB Todos los dispositivos de la serie μFR requieren los controladores FTDI para la comunicación USB. Esto también se aplica al lector NFC μFR Nano Online si se utiliza como un dispositivo USB estándar.Si no tiene controladores FTDI instalados en su Raspberry Pi instalada, siga el manual de los controladores FTDI instalados en las plataformas basadas en Linux. Este artículo también está disponible en nuestra Base de conocimientos. Aviso importante: Antes de continuar con la implementación de μFR Nano Online, asegúrese de conceder el permiso de acceso al puerto USB al usuario local (el script está disponible en nuestro repositorio de proyectos de GitLab). Una vez que tenga los controladores FTDI instalados con su lector NFC conectado por USB, podrá abrir el puerto y establecer comunicación con el dispositivo mediante la función ReaderOpen proporcionada por la biblioteca ufr. Aviso importante: La biblioteca recomendada para la Raspberry Pi es la aarch64 de 64 bits. Sin...
Ejecución de Python SDK/software en macOS
Last Updated: marzo 30, 2023Para ejemplos de software de Python, le sugerimos que use cualquier versión de Python 3.x.x. Si no tiene instalada la versión correcta de Python, use la siguiente línea de comandos para instalar una nueva versión: brew install python Ahora simplemente ejecute nuestro ejemplo de software de código fuente con el comando: python3 file_name.py Tenga en cuenta que nuestra estructura del SDK de Python solo tiene un archivo de .py ejecutable (archivo principal) y que uno importa todos los demás archivos como módulos. Por ejemplo, la consola del SDK de Python de NDEF utiliza ndef_example.py como archivo principal, por lo que el software se ejecuta con el siguiente comando: python3 ndef_example.py Para asegurarse de qué archivo es el archivo ejecutable principal, simplemente puede verificar el código fuente de los archivos *.py y buscar el que tenga una función ReaderOpen / ReaderOpenEx llamadas. Nota : esta prueba se realizó con Python 3.7.2 so e incluyó el siguiente SDK: https://code.d-logic.com/nfc-rfid-reader-sdk/ufr-ndef-examples-python-console https://code.d-logic.com/nfc-rfid-reader-sdk/ufr-mf-examples-c
Error de apertura del lector en macOS – Código (0x54)
Last Updated: marzo 30, 2023Los controladores FTDI en algunas versiones de macOS pueden causar un error al intentar abrir el lector mediante algunas de las herramientas del SDK de μFR. Si está a punto de usar macOS Catalina y versiones posteriores, es posible que tenga algunos problemas para usar las funciones ReaderOpen() o ReaderOpenEx(). En caso de que obtenga el estado "READER_OPENING_ERROR (0x54)", verifique lo siguiente: macOS Catalina y, en consecuencia, Big Sur deben confiar en su propio controlador AppleUSBFTDI. Para ejecutar nuestro SDK correctamente, debe descargar cualquier otro controlador presente actualmente. Compruebe los controladores FTDI cargados con el siguiente comando: kextstat | grep -i ftd Si el "com. FTDI.driver.FTDIUSBSerialDriver", o una cadena similar sin la cadena "Apple" en su nombre aparece en la salida del terminal, debe descargarla. Por ejemplo, durante nuestras pruebas utilizamos el siguiente comando para descargar un controlador suficiente: sudo kextunload /Library/StagedExtensions/Library/Extensions/FTDIUSBSerialDriver.kext Después de este paso, no hubo problemas para ejecutar las funciones ReaderOpen/ReaderOpenEx desde nuestra API. También copiamos el archivo dylib a /usr/local/lib: sudo cp Desktop/D2XX/libftd2xx.1.4.22.dylib /usr/local/lib/libftd2xx.1.4.22.dylib Estos dos pasos deberían resolver todos los problemas de comunicación del controlador FTDI entre el lector y el host. Espero que estas instrucciones te ayuden a resolver el problema. Estamos a su...
Estructura de Mifare® – ayuda de programación de tarjetas
Last Updated: marzo 30, 2023¿Hay algún dispositivo de la serie μFR que se dirija directamente a través de la interfaz USB y javax.smartcard?
Last Updated: marzo 30, 2023¿Existe algún ejemplo de aplicación de consola simple para la lectura continua?
Last Updated: marzo 30, 2023¿Hay algún SDK para C# .NET Core 3.1?
Last Updated: marzo 30, 2023¿La etiqueta SUN Mirroring NT4H está disponible con dispositivos uFR?
Last Updated: abril 10, 2023Configuración de RF del dispositivo μFR: restablecer a los valores predeterminados
Last Updated: marzo 30, 2023Controlador PS/CS de Windows para dispositivos de la serie μFR
Last Updated: marzo 30, 2023¿Qué software usar para obtener el PAN de la tarjeta de crédito y todos los datos públicos?
Last Updated: marzo 30, 2023¿Qué firmware usar en un dispositivo con ranura SAM?
Last Updated: marzo 30, 2023¿Qué dispositivos pertenecen a la serie μFR?
Last Updated: marzo 30, 2023¿Cuál es el propósito de la actualización rtC y EEPROM para el dispositivo μFR?
Last Updated: marzo 30, 2023RTC integrado Algunos proyectos requieren una hora actual precisa en lugar de depender de la hora del sistema de PC o la hora del host. Aceptar el tiempo de estas fuentes conlleva un riesgo potencial porque se puede cambiar a propósito, causando una posible vulnerabilidad del sistema y problemas de seguridad. Por esta razón, el módulo RTC incorporado de los lectores garantiza un cronometraje preciso sin ninguna influencia de su entorno. El tiempo establecido para el lector se puede modificar solo con autenticación de contraseña. EEPROM integrada La EEPROM de usuario es parte de la memoria no volátil para almacenar pequeñas cantidades de datos importantes, como claves de licencia y similares. También es un área protegida por contraseña: se requiere una contraseña válida para escribir datos en esa área. La lectura de datos también está disponible solo con una contraseña proporcionada. Esta característica es muy conveniente para la integración del dispositivo con el software personalizado u otro proyecto complejo.
Utilice los métodos NDEF con el NT4H en el lector μFR Nano (por ejemplo, erase_all_ndef_records) – mensaje de estado NDEF_UNSUPPORTED_CARD_TYPE
Last Updated: marzo 30, 2023¿Cómo usar los métodos NDEF con el NT4H (por ejemplo, erase_all_ndef_records) en el lector μFR Nano si obtiene un estado NDEF_UNSUPPORTED_CARD_TYPE?
Instalación de dispositivos de la serie μFR en distribuciones Linux
Last Updated: diciembre 21, 2020Biblioteca μFR NFC Reader para dispositivos Android
Last Updated: marzo 30, 2023Conexión μFR Nano TTL
Last Updated: marzo 30, 2023¿Está disponible la biblioteca para la arquitectura ARM (para Linux en la Raspberry Pi)?
Last Updated: marzo 30, 2023Entre otros, μFR Series SDK incluye las bibliotecas para los procesadores ARM. Por favor, compruebe todo el soporte disponible a continuación. Bibliotecas de la serie μFR Las bibliotecas de la serie μFR están disponibles para las siguientes plataformas: Windows 32 y 64 bits (estático y dinámico) Windows ARM Linux de 32 y 64 bits (solo dinámico) Linux ARM y ARM-HF (solo dinámico) Mac OSX de 32 y 64 bits (solo dinámico) iOS de 64 bits (solo estático). Descargar bibliotecas https://code.d-logic.com/nfc-rfid-reader-sdk/ufr-lib del repositorio de GitLab Puesta en práctica Encuentre más detalles en la referencia de la API de la serie μFR. Para obtener información rápida y los prototipos de funciones, verifique el archivo de encabezado /include/ufCoder.h. Requisitos Dispositivo de la serie μFR. Aviso Estas bibliotecas son específicas del hardware enumerado SOLAMENTE.No hay garantía de que puedan ser funcionales con cualquier otro hardware.
¿Está previsto el desarrollo de comandos NDEF (por ejemplo, comandos reset/clear) compatibles con NT4H?
Last Updated: marzo 30, 2023¿Es posible el cambio de marca del lector RFID NFC?
Last Updated: marzo 30, 2023Algunos de los productos de Digital Logic ya están disponibles con carcasas / carcasas personalizables, mientras que las versiones OEM no tienen la marca como producto final. Para obtener más detalles sobre cómo marcar el dispositivo específico, póngase en contacto con nuestro servicio de atención al cliente.
¿Es posible duplicar una etiqueta Vigik® con una herramienta de Digital Logic?
Last Updated: marzo 30, 2023Las etiquetas Vigik® tienen un chip MIFARE Classic® 1K o MIFARE Ultralight® incorporado. Aunque los dispositivos de la serie uFR admiten estos chips, la lectura de la etiqueta Vigik® requiere conocer un conjunto específico de claves de seguridad utilizadas para programarlos. Además, el sistema Vigik® utiliza un nivel adicional de protección (cifrado de datos) utilizando un algoritmo de 1024 bits que es casi imposible de romper.
Cómo comunicarse con un dispositivo μFR en Windows sin implementación de controladores FTDI
Last Updated: marzo 30, 2023Cómo usar el dispositivo μFR en Windows sin la implementación de controladores FTDI: Puede evitar el uso de controladores FTDI (D2XX) comunicándose con el lector a través de
Compatibilidad con iOS para hardware de la serie μFR
Last Updated: marzo 30, 2023Para iOS, proporcionamos la biblioteca de hardware de la serie μFR para iOS, las API y otra documentación relacionada con el hardware, así como todo el soporte técnico necesario para el desarrollo de su proyecto. En cuanto a las herramientas de desarrollo y las soluciones de software ejecutables, el SDK actual compatible con iOS está disponible en nuestro repositorio gitlab y las dos aplicaciones en App Store.El SDK es compatible con todos los dispositivos de la serie μFR, mientras que una de las dos aplicaciones iOS disponibles está desarrollada exclusivamente para el lector μFR Nano Online .
Cómo configurar el software formateador de tarjetas μFR para configurar los bits de acceso y las claves de seguridad para cada sector de una tarjeta MIFARE 1K
Last Updated: marzo 30, 2023La GUI del formateador de la tarjeta μFR muestra toda la estructura MIFARE Classic 1K con acceso simple a todos sus sectores y bloques (16 sectores de 4 bloques). El primer bloque (bloque cero) contiene el UID de fábrica de la tarjeta, y es de solo lectura de forma predeterminada.
¿Cómo integrar el lector NFC al sistema de gestión basado en la web a través del navegador?
Last Updated: marzo 30, 2023Cómo integrar el hardware de Digital Logic en otros dispositivos y sistemas como PLC y placas integradas
Last Updated: marzo 30, 2023Descubra cómo integrar el hardware RFID NFC de Digital Logic en otros dispositivos y sistemas, PLC y placas integradas...
¿Cómo evitar la implementación de puertos COM virtuales y controladores FTDI en el sistema operativo Windows?
Last Updated: marzo 30, 2023¿Algún dispositivo de Digital Logic admite etiquetas de 125Hz?
Last Updated: marzo 30, 2023¿Los lectores de Digital Logic son compatibles con P2P (Peer To Peer)?
Last Updated: marzo 30, 2023La función P2P (Peer To Peer) para dispositivos de lógica digital aún no está completamente desarrollada. Siga nuestro blog de noticias para mantenerse al día con nuestros procesos de proyectos y nuevos lanzamientos.
Configurar Raspbian para Raspberry Pi 3 para usar digital Logic shield con dispositivos RS232 de la serie μFR
Last Updated: marzo 30, 2023Configurar Raspbian para Raspberry Pi 3 para usar Digital Logic shield con uFReader RS232
Last Updated: marzo 30, 2023Error de lectura de tarjeta/etiqueta en el software de la consola NT4H C con la versión de firmware del dispositivo 5.0.52
Last Updated: marzo 30, 2023La versión de firmware (actualmente más reciente) 5.0.52 puede provocar algún error en las funciones del SDK o la congelación de la consola (problema detectado en el software ufr-examples-c-nt4h). Si está experimentando un problema de este tipo, la solución es instalar otra versión de firmware en su dispositivo. Si hay una nueva versión de firmware disponible en nuestra lista de actualizaciones de firmware, recomendamos la degradación del firmware. La actualización o degradación del firmware a la versión 5.0.51 resuelve este problema. Para instalar el nuevo firmware, puede utilizar la configuración web de μFR Nano Online (IP del dispositivo), buscar las versiones de firmware disponibles y seleccionar la última versión de firmware disponible o la versión 5.0.51 de la lista. Alternativamente, para este propósito, también puede usar software de escritorio https://code.d-logic.com/nfc-rfid-reader-sdk/ufr_online-flasher-oneclick.
Problema de distancia de lectura de tarjetas
Last Updated: marzo 30, 2023¿Se pueden utilizar dispositivos μFR en proyectos OpenWRT?
Last Updated: marzo 30, 2023OpenWRT (OPEN Wireless Router) es un proyecto de código abierto para sistemas operativos embebidos basados en Linux, utilizado principalmente en dispositivos embebidos para enrutar el tráfico de red. La aplicación de dispositivos de la serie μFR en proyectos OpenWRT aún no se ha probado. Dado que estos dispositivos tienen soporte completo para entornos basados en Linux y Linx (por ejemplo, Raspberry Pi, BeagleBone, etc.), la implementación en OpenWRT teóricamente debería ser fácil de lograr. Aunque las bibliotecas MIPS aún no se compilaron, las bibliotecas ARM y x86 se pueden utilizar para el desarrollo de estos proyectos. Obtenga más información sobre https://dev.openwrt.org/wiki/platforms.
¿Pueden los dispositivos Digital Logic leer y escribir tarjetas/etiquetas Mifare Ultralight ®, Mifare Ultralight® C, Mifare Ultralight® EV1?
Last Updated: marzo 30, 2023Actualmente, la mayoría de los dispositivos Digital Logic admiten tarjetas/etiquetas Mifare Ultralight®. Mifare Ultralight® C es compatible con el modo de compatibilidad (como Ultralight® estándar). El soporte para tarjetas / etiquetas Mifare Ultralight® EV1 aún está en desarrollo. Consulte la tabla de características de hardware seleccionada para obtener los detalles de todas las tarjetas/etiquetas compatibles.